Introduction to Food Processors

Food processors are electrical appliances designed to perform a multitude of tasks, from simple chopping and slicing to more complex functions like kneading dough and emulsifying sauces. These devices have become indispensable in modern kitchens, saving time and effort by automating many tedious and labor-intensive processes. A typical food processor consists of a base, a bowl, a lid, and various accessories, including blades, discs, and other specialized tools.

Components of a Food Processor

To understand whether a food processor has a blade, it’s essential to familiarize yourself with its components. The primary elements of a food processor include:

The base, which houses the motor and controls
The bowl, where ingredients are placed for processing
The lid, which fits on top of the bowl to contain the ingredients and protect against spills
The blade and disc assembly, which is responsible for performing various tasks

Blade Materials and Construction

The materials used to construct food processor blades can vary, but stainless steel and titanium are the most common choices due to their durability, resistance to corrosion, and non-reactive properties. Some blades may also feature a non-stick coating to prevent ingredients from sticking and to make cleaning easier.

In terms of construction, blades can be either fixed or removable. Fixed blades are attached to the disc assembly and cannot be removed, while removable blades can be taken out and washed separately or replaced with other blades.

What types of blades are commonly found in food processors?

The most common types of blades found in food processors are the chopping blade, slicing blade, and shredding blade. The chopping blade is typically a stainless steel or titanium blade with a curved or angled edge, designed for general-purpose chopping and cutting. The slicing blade is usually a thinner, more precise blade with a straight edge, used for creating uniform slices of food. The shredding blade, on the other hand, is often a more intricate design with multiple cutting edges, used for shredding or grating ingredients like cheese, carrots, or cabbage.

In addition to these basic blade types, some food processors may come with specialized blades for tasks like kneading dough, chopping nuts, or pureeing soups. Are food processor blades safe to use and clean?

Food processor blades can be safe to use and clean if handled properly. However, they can also be hazardous if users are not careful, as the blades are typically very sharp and can cause cuts or other injuries. To ensure safe use, users should always follow the manufacturer’s instructions, handle the blades with care, and keep their fingers and hands away from the blade assembly.

Regular cleaning is also essential to maintain the safety and performance of the food processor blade. Users should wash the blade in warm soapy water, dry it thoroughly, and store it in a safe place when not in use. Some food processors may also have dishwasher-safe blades, which can make cleaning easier and more convenient.
